Filicudi was sunk 2/4/17 off Trapani.
As far as Mazzini O., she is not even listed by Lloyd's, I just discovered of her existance from some papers which have recently arrived from Italy but are very vague due to being records of a commission whose work was cut short by the Fascist coup of 28/10/22. As far as I know, she may very well have been lost on a field laid by KuK surface ships, I was just leaving the door open to the possibility of a mineleying sub being responsible & not credited by Bendert.
